Popular Courses in Multimedia and Animation
1. Diploma Courses
- Diploma in Animation
- Diploma in Multimedia Design
- Diploma in VFX (Visual Effects)
Duration: 6 months to 1 year
Best for: Beginners or skill based learning
2. Undergraduate Courses
- B.Sc. in Animation and Multimedia
- Bachelor of Animation
- BFA (Bachelor of Fine Arts) in Digital Arts
Duration: 3 to 4 years.
Best for: Students after 12th.
3. Postgraduate Courses
- M.Sc. in Animation
- MA in Multimedia
- PG Diploma in Animation & VFX
Duration: 1 to 2 years
Best for: Specialization and advanced learning.
4. Certification Courses
Short term online or offline certifications in:
- 3D Animation
- Graphic Design
- Video Editing
- Motion Graphics
Best for: Skill upgrade and freelancing.

Salary Expectations
Salary depends on skills, experience, and specialization:
- Freshers: Rs. 2 to 4 LPA
- Mid-level: Rs. 5 to 8 LPA
- Experienced professionals: Rs. 10+ LPA
Freelancers can earn even more based on projects and clients.

Top 20 Multimedia & Animation Institutes in India (With Address)
Government & Premium Institutes
1. National Institute of Design: Paldi, Ahmedabad, Gujarat – 380007, Website – https://www.nid.edu/home
2. IDC School of Design IIT Bombay: IIT Bombay Campus, Powai, Mumbai, Maharashtra – 400076, Website – https://www.idc.iitb.ac.in/
3. Srishti Manipal Institute of Art Design and Technology: Yelahanka, Bengaluru, Karnataka – 560064, Website – https://srishtimanipalinstitute.in/
4. Whistling Woods International: Film City Complex, Goregaon East, Mumbai, Maharashtra – 400065, Website – https://www.whistlingwoods.net/
5. AJK Mass Communication Research Centre Jamia Millia Islamia: Jamia Nagar, New Delhi – 110025, Website – https://jmi.ac.in/
Private Leading Animation Institutes
6. Arena Animation: M-3, 3rd Floor, AVG Bhawan, Connaught Place, New Delhi – 110001
7. Maya Academy of Advanced Cinematics MAAC: PP Tower, Netaji Subhash Place, Pitampura, New Delhi – 110088
8. Frameboxx Animation and Visual Effects: Multiple centres across India (Head offices in Mumbai & Delhi)
9. Zee Institute of Creative Art ZICA: Multiple centres across major cities in India
10. Toonz Academy: Technopark Campus,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ala – 695581
11. FX School Mumbai: Andheri West, Mumbai, Maharashtra – 400053
12. Picasso Animation College: South Extension Part II, New Delhi – 110049
13. JMD Animation Institute: Ashok Vihar Phase-1, Delhi – 110052
Specialized & Emerging Institutes
14. AAFT School of Animation: Film City, Sector 16A, Noida, Uttar Pradesh – 201301
15. Apeejay Institute of Design: Tughlakabad Institutional Area, New Delhi – 110062
16. Birla Institute of Technology Mesra: BIT Noida Campus, Sector-1, Noida, Uttar Pradesh
17. Indian Institute of Digital Art and Animation: Kolkata, West Bengal
18. National Institute of Film and Fine Arts: Kolkata, West Bengal
19. St Xavier’s College Kolkata: 30 Park Street, Kolkata, West Bengal – 700016
20. Artoonz Media School of Animation: Exhibition Road, Patna, Bihar – 800001
India offers a wide range of Multimedia and Animation institutes from Top Government design schools to job oriented private academies. Institutes like NID and IIT Bombay focus on Creativity and Research, while Arena, MAAC and Frameboxx provide practical, industry ready training.
